Chapter 3
Navigation script steps
Navigation script steps move to different areas of a database. Use Navigation script steps
to:
• go to a specific record or find request
• switch to a specific layout
• move among fields on a layout
• emulate pressing Enter or Tab
• switch to Browse mode to work with contents of a file
• switch to Find mode to fill out find requests
• switch to Preview mode to see how records, forms, or reports will look when they're
printed
